OCSNA will host the second of its two annual General Neighborhood Meetings at the Willie Galimore Center, 399 Riberia Street, on Tuesday, October 23 from 6pm to 8pm.
The meeting will begin with a question and answer forum with SAPD Chief of Police Barry Fox. Following the Q & A with Chief Fox, the OCSNA board will update members on the state of the neighborhood association as well as on several items that the board has been working on this year: the establishment of a St. Francis Park Committee, the member section of the OCSNA website, participation in the city’s holiday parade, the First Annual OCSNA Fall Potluck Party, and a discussion of the results of this past spring’s membership criteria survey.
